Day nine - Berlin to Cologne

Our hotel was less than a mile from the railway station, with a lovely walk through the Tiergarten to Hauftbanhof reminding us why train travel is so much more pleasurable than flying. We wandered through the park, then through the station and onto the train, with our tickets (and Interrail passes) only checked once, we were well on our four hour way to Cologne.

Another day spent wandering the streets - Cologne is such a beautiful city and it was a great place to end this holiday. We even found a great vegan restaurant right near the river. Having done boat trips in Copenhagen, Malmo and Berlin, we resisted the temptation to cruise the Rhein, but it was close.
